My Checklist
Keep track of the tasks and deadlines listed on this page, they're there to help you prepare for the event. Every time you complete a task, it will be checked off from this list.
- Tip: don't forget to select the correct type of organisation for your company (task "Select the type of organisation to show on your exhibitor profile"), so people can find you when they use the filters available on the Exhibitor List.
My Profile
Update your company profile on this page, as many times as you need before the event. We encourage you to keep your company description short and appealing and let your potential leads find out more about you on your website. The information added to the page My Profile will be automatically available on the Exhibitor List on the ETCSEE website.
- Tip: include information on your profile about what you are showcasing, products you are launching, who is speaking at the conference from your company, etc.; make sure to include the most common keywords associated with your business that people will use on the search box; if you want to include more detailed information about your company, add a link to the "About" page or any other page on your website.
My Messages
Our website visitors can connect with you by sending a message via your profile on the Exhibitor List; you will be able to manage all your messages on the page My Messages. You will receive an email notification every time you have a new message.
Marketing
The Marketing tab includes information and materials that will help you promote your involvement with the event, including promotional banners and the option to upload your Press Releases and Brochures, which will be displayed on your company profile on the Exhibitor List on the ETCSEE website.
- Tip: the more content you upload to the Exhibitor Portal, the better your potential clients can get to know you and the more likely it is that you are found on our website; don't forget to upload your Press Releases and other content related to your products and services, so that our visitors can get to know your offer way ahead of the event.
